Cookies - Pineapple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:

2 Eggs
1 Cup Brown Sugar
1 Cup Granulated Sugar
3/4 Cup Shortening
4 Cups Flour
1 tsp Baking Soda
1/2 tsp Salt
1 Small can Crushed Pineapple
1 tsp Vanilla
1 Cup Nuts (chopped)

Directions:

In large mixing bowl, cream together eggs, brown sugar, granulated sugar, and shortening. Sift flour, baking soda and salt together and add alternately to sugar mixture along with the pineapple. Fold in vanilla and nuts. Drop by teaspoonfuls on greased cookie sheet.

Bake at 400º for 12 mins.

Personal Notes:

Makes a soft cookie. These cookies are good iced with vanilla frosting.
